How to Configure Dynamic IP Address (DHCP) Using Command Prompt(CMD)
In this video, I will show you guys how to configured dynamic IP Address or DHCP IP address using CMD in your Windows 10 Computer. You can also try this method on your other Windows Version like Windows 7, Windows 8.1 etc.
Commands:
ipconfig
netsh interface ip set address "Ethernet" dhcp
